Amarapura, Burma, 1908. The city of Amarapura was founded in 1782 and was twice (1783-1823 and 1837-1860) the capital of Burma under the Konbaung dynasty. Its royal palace, great temples, and fortifications are now in ruins. Stereoscopic card. Detail.
